About the event

Madison Gonzalez, FL Gulf Coast University Sr majoring in Marine Science & minor in Climate Science. She will graduate later this year and will pursue a masters degree in environmental policy and management. Her goal is a career in the environmental permitting/regulation field. Currently, she is in the Florida Audubon's Conservation Leadership Initiative Mentoring Program with the Peace River Audubon Local Chapter. Bren Curtis is her mentor and her project is initiating community awareness of Burrowing Owls in Charlotte County.
